Autograph letter signed from Natalia Janotha to Charles Flower, Avonbank, Stratford on Avon [manuscript], 1891 February 21.

Signed "Janotha." Indicates that May would be better for her, since she will be on tour in Poland in April. She would "play with joy - as much as the program would need." Suggests that perhaps Lyttelton "could kindly sing some new songs of Lady Tennyson." Correspondent's address appears as 51 N. B[on?]d St.

2 leaves ; 16 x 10 cm.
